Analysis
Least Developed Countries (LDCs) recorded 196,340 1000 USD for grapes — gross production value in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 4.4% on the previous year and down 3.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, grapes — gross production value in Least Developed Countries (LDCs) peaked at 225,902 1000 USD in 2003 and was at its lowest, 13,918 1000 USD, in 1970.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 27,802 1000 USD | 25,147 1000 USD | 32,627 1000 USD | 9 |
| 1970s | 49,959 1000 USD | 13,918 1000 USD | 66,812 1000 USD | 10 |
| 1980s | 124,274 1000 USD | 74,986 1000 USD | 180,153 1000 USD | 10 |
| 1990s | 190,433 1000 USD | 132,068 1000 USD | 208,178 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2000s | 183,298 1000 USD | 140,705 1000 USD | 225,902 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2010s | 193,414 1000 USD | 165,412 1000 USD | 222,583 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2020s | 196,394 1000 USD | 183,606 1000 USD | 205,414 1000 USD | 5 |

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
